One popular traditional game played by Algerian children is called "El Ankabout" or "The Spider." This game involves a group of children forming a circle while one child, designated as the spider, tries to tag the other children who must avoid being caught. The game requires agility, quick reflexes, and teamwork, making it a fun and exciting activity for children of all ages. In addition to "El Ankabout," another common game enjoyed by Algerian children is "El Koura" or "The Ball." Similar to soccer, this game is played with a ball made of stitched fabric or rubber. Children gather in open spaces such as parks or playgrounds to kick the ball around, showcasing their skills and sportsmanship. Moving on to Abu Dhabi, the capital city of the United Arab Emirates (UAE), children in this modern and cosmopolitan city also engage in a variety of games and activities. Despite the urban setting, Abu Dhabi offers ample opportunities for children to play and have fun. One popular recreational activity for children in Abu Dhabi is visiting the numerous parks and playgrounds scattered across the city. These well-maintained green spaces provide a safe and enjoyable environment for children to run, jump, and play with their friends. Moreover, Abu Dhabi is home to world-class family entertainment venues such as Ferrari World, Yas Waterworld, and Warner Bros. World Abu Dhabi. These theme parks offer a wide range of thrilling rides, interactive attractions, and entertainment shows that cater to children of all ages, making them popular destinations for families looking to have a fun day out.
